Dear Parents and Teachers, I wanted to share this Montessori fun and educational activity to help your child learn and remember each alphabet letter. This activity involves finding and identifying letters throughout the book, making the learning process enjoyable and engaging. Begin reading the book together, encouraging your child to pay attention to the letters on each page. When you come across a letter, ask your child to point it out and say its name. Repeat this process for each letter of the alphabet as you progress through the book. Take breaks if needed, and make sure to provide positive reinforcement and praise for your child's efforts. By actively searching for and identifying letters in the book, your child will develop letter recognition skills and improve their alphabet knowledge. This activity combines reading, visual learning, and hands-on engagement, making it a fun and effective way to learn the alphabet. Henry James’s Daisy Miller was an immediate sensation when it was first published in 1878 and has remained popular ever since. In this novella, the charming but inscrutable young American of the title shocks European society with her casual indifference to its social mores. The novella was popular in part because of the debates it sparked about foreign travel, the behaviour of women, and cultural clashes between people of different nationalities and social classes. This Broadview edition presents an early version of James’s best-known novella within the cultural contexts of its day. In addition to primary materials about nineteenth-century womanhood, foreign travel, medicine, philosophy, theatre, and art—some of the topics that interested James as he was writing the story—this volume includes James’s ruminations on fiction, theatre, and writing, and presents excerpts of Daisy Miller as he rewrote it for the theatre and for a much later and heavily revised edition.

"Winter Dreams" is a short story by F. Scott Fitzgerald that first appeared in Metropolitan Magazine in December 1922, and was collected in All the Sad Young Men in 1926. It is considered one of Fitzgerald's finest stories and is frequently anthologized. In the Fitzgerald canon, it is considered to be in the "Gatsby-cluster," as many of its themes were later expanded upon in his famous novel The Great Gatsby in 1925.
